Kornmesser, Traditional restaurant in Kornmarktstraße, Bregenz, Austria
Kornmesser is a restaurant in Bregenz serving Austrian cuisine with around 20 dishes including Wienerschnitzel, Tafelspitz, and regional specialties. The restored dining space spans two levels with multiple rooms and a wine cellar.
The building dates from 1720 and features baroque architecture. Thomas and Theresia Zwerger took over management in June 2019 and continue to run the establishment.
The menu features regional specialties like Verhackertes, Rinderkraftsuppe, and Kaiserschmarren with plum compote that reflect everyday Vorarlberg cooking traditions. These dishes show how local food customs are still practiced today.
